About the roleThis position is responsible for the build and repair of new and existing dies, tooling, and automation components. This position provides support to the production departments by assisting in solving problems and repairing existing tooling and automation.

Responsibilities

  • Interprets tooling specifications, blueprints, and sketches
  • Plans sequence of operations for fabricating components
  • Sets up and operates mills, lathes, grinders, including CNC controlled, and other machining equipment
  • Makes and repairs cutting tools, jigs, fixtures, and gauges
  • Fits, assembles and trouble shoots dies, molds, and assembly equipment
  • Takes direction from the section Technician III or from the Tool Room Manager
  • Analyzes the assignment and proceeds in a professional, timely manner until the assignment is complete
  • Informs Toolmaker III of project progress and completion
  • Completes assignments within proper quality specifications
